3
Seeds (1)
The cycle begins with the seed. The seed contains the embryo of the plant and energy storage molecules. The seed has a seed coat to protect it. Once the seed is exposed to water, the outer coat ruptures. Metabolic (chemical) reactions take place that restart the growth of embryo into a plant.
4
Seeds (2)
Seeds store food by the embryo in the form of a molecule called starch (a large carbohydrate that is constructed of long chains of glucose). All cells need glucose for cellular energy. The embryo needs to break these chains into glucose (a simple sugar), so it can use it as energy.
5
Enzymes
Enzymes: protein molecules that cause chemical reactions to proceed in living organisms
Certain enzymes in plants break down large starch molecules into individual glucose molecules.
6
Benedict's Solution
There needs to be a way to see if starch was broken down. For this we use "Benedict's Solution." This solution changes color in the presence of glucose. If the solution doesn't change color, the starch wasn't broken down.
